Area of Expertise: Suicide; depression; psychotherapy; brain function
Biography
Ian Cook, associate professor of psychiatry, is director of depression research at the Semel Institute for Neuroscience and Human Behavior at UCLA. He comments regularly on issues related to depression, psychotherapy and suicide rates.
 
Cook specializes in research aimed at improving treatment for brain disorders. He has written extensively about brain function in mental illness and in aging.
